#72987e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72987e is composed of 44.7% red, 59.6%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.1%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 138.9 degrees, a saturation of 15.6% and a lightness of 52.2%. #72987e color hex could be obtained by blending #e4fffc with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#72987e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#72987e has RGB values of R:114, G:152,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 7510142.
